Having spent quite some time exploring Beverly Hills, I can confidently say it’s one of the most captivating places in Los Angeles. From the stunning palm-lined streets to the high-end boutiques and elegant dining options, the neighborhood blends luxury with a unique Californian charm. What really stands out is the friendly atmosphere coupled with the iconic architecture that you just don’t find anywhere else. I remember taking leisurely walks along Rodeo Drive, marveling at the designer stores, yet feeling welcomed even as a casual visitor. The mix of tourists and locals creates a vibrant community vibe that’s both exciting and relaxing. In addition to shopping and dining, Beverly Hills offers beautiful parks and landmarks, perfect for unwinding after a busy day. Beyond its surface luxury, I found the history of Beverly Hills fascinating. It evolved from a quiet ranch area into a glamorous hub, attracting celebrities and creatives alike. This blend of culture and lifestyle makes Beverly Hills special—not just another affluent neighborhood but a symbol of LA's dynamic spirit. For anyone visiting Los Angeles, I would highly recommend dedicating at least half a day to explore Beverly Hills. Whether you’re snapping photos, shopping, or simply soaking in the scenery, it’s an experience that captures the essence of LA’s allure. Plus, the proximity to other iconic locations like Hollywood and Santa Monica adds to the convenience and appeal.
